Configure CoS Drop Precedence Settings
To configure CoS Drop Precedence settings:
1. 
Launch a web browser.
2. 
Enter http://<ipaddress> in the web browser address field.
The login window opens.
3. 
Enter the user name and password. 
The default admin user name is admin and the default admin password is blank, that is, 
do not enter a password.
4. 
Click the Login button. 
The System Information page displays.
5. 
Select QoS > CoS> Advanced > CoS Queue Drop Precedence Configuration.
6. 
Use Interface to specify all CoS configurable interfaces.
7. 
Use Queue ID to specify all the available queues. 
Valid values are 0 to 6. The default is 0.
8. 
Use Drop Precedence Level to specify all the available drop precedence levels. 
Valid values are 1 to 4. The default is 1.
9. 
Use WRED Minimum Threshold to specify the weighted RED minimum queue threshold 
below which no packets are dropped for the current drop precedence level. 
The range is 0 to 100. The default is 40.
10. 
Use WRED Maximum Threshold to specify the weighted RED maximum queue threshold 
above which all packets are dropped for the current drop precedence level. 
The range is 0 to 100. The default is 100.
